Passion
By Deaths Angel
I dreamt I met a lord in a wood one shaded day. He said, "your passion is a glutton, it devours what it may. As it consumes, it's hunger grows, for that is passions toll. I see it burns beneath your breast, it may soon devour your soul." Then the lord fell silent and held me in his eye. 'Twas if he even ceased to breathe till i gave him my reply. "My blood burns red with passion, my love a gouging knife. I bleed into a blackend book my passion and my life. For passion is a glutton, this fact I don't deny.
